Sustainable market growth in Norway

Message from Bruno Koch:

“After reading the great E-Invoicing figures for the Swedish market we published in our previous newsletter, Norwegian colleagues reacted promptly and provided me with their own impressive results. BBS reports that B2C E-Invoicing processed by banks and related associations has seen an even better development, with an increase in volume from 17.8 million in 2008 to 24.1 million in 2009 (+36%).

The number of unique B2C receivers/consumers for 2009 was 1.2 million, compared with 825,000 in 2008 (+48%). Consumers in Norway receive on average electronic invoices from 4.1 issuers
